🏛️ Key Characteristics of Baroque Furniture

1. Ornate Carvings

  • Lavish, deep carvings featuring:
    • Acanthus leaves
    • Cherubs and angels
    • Scrolls and shells
    • Mythological or biblical scenes

2. Bold, Heavy Proportions

  • Furniture is large, solid, and imposing.
  • Legs and arms are thick and often twisted (Solomonic) or scroll-shaped.

3. Symmetry and Grandeur

  • Designs are highly symmetrical and balanced.
  • Emphasis on drama and theatricality—meant to awe the viewer.

4. Rich Materials

  • Dark woods like walnut, ebony, and rosewood.
  • Gilding (gold leaf), marquetry, and inlays with ivory, tortoiseshell, or brass.
  • Velvet or brocade upholstery in deep reds, golds, and purples.

5. Architectural Influence

  • Furniture often mimics architectural elements:
    • Columns, pediments, and cornices
    • Paneling and pilasters

🪑 Common Baroque Furniture Types

  • Throne-like armchairs with high backs and elaborate carvings
  • Cabinets and commodes with curved fronts and gilded mounts
  • Console tables with marble tops and ornate bases
  • Canopy beds with heavy drapery and carved headboards

🧑‍🎨 Notable Designers

  • André-Charles Boulle (France): Master of marquetry and ormolu.
  • Gian Lorenzo Bernini (Italy): Architect and sculptor whose influence extended to furniture design.
